Bills close out in record-setting fashion
‘Buffalo’s 56 points scored are the most since it beat Miami, 58-24, at War Memorial Stadium in 1966. The victory also marked the first time the Bills have gone unbeaten in the division (6-0) in franchise history and their 13-win season is only the third time they have reached that total as the 1990 and ‘91 squads also went 13-3.’

Bills Eliminate Dolphins With 56-26 Rout; Set To Host Colts
‘In a season-ending game in which the Dolphins had far more riding on the outcome, the Bills put an empathic stamp on their breakthrough year with a 56-26 rout on Sunday. In clinching the AFC’s second seed, Buffalo will host its first playoff game in 24 years by facing the the Frank Reich-coached Indianapolis Colts next Saturday at 1 :05 p.m. EST.’
Bills close with 56-26 win over Miami, set to face Colts
‘Buffalo (13-3) finished with a season-best 501 points scored, matched a franchise record for victories set in 1990 and ’91, and looked nothing like the inconsistent team that finished last season by squandering a 16-0 second-half lead in a 22-19 overtime loss at the Houston Texans in an AFC wild-card game.’

Dolphins at Bills score: Buffalo secures the No. 2 seed in the AFC in blowout win over Miami
‘In one half of action, Allen completed 18 of his 25 passes for 224 yards and three touchdowns while also throwing an interception. Two of those passing touchdowns fell into the arms of receiver Isaiah McKenzie, who had three total scores on the day and in the opening half. The other came courtesy of an 84-yard punt return that helped put Buffalo up by 18 points with just over five minutes to go prior to the half. Matt Barkley ended up relieving Allen in the second half, but Buffalo’s B Team continued to pour it on the Dolphins, outscoring them 28-20 over the final two quarters.’

Bills blow past Dolphins in regular season finale
‘The Isaiah McKenzie show wasn’t over with just the pair of receiving scores. The receiver added to his already impressive performance with an 84-yard punt return touchdown, the first by a Bills player since 2014, stretching the lead to 21-3 with 5:22 remaining until halftime. McKenzie finished the game with six catches for 65 yards to go along with his two scores.’
